Latest News
28 Mar, 2024
Nairobi
23 ° C
Search
a

Section 375 Tag

A love story set in snowy hilly regions of Himachal Pradesh with all of the complexities of love.

A filmmaker stands trial when a costume assistant on his movie accuses him of rape.